"You're Wicked If You Intentionally Date a Married Man" – Daniel Regha

Media personality Daniel Regha has issued a stern warning to women who intentionally date married men for benefits, describing such behaviour as wicked and morally unacceptable.

Regha, who is known for his blunt and often controversial opinions on social issues, made the statement in a post on X that has since gone viral. According to him, women who knowingly enter into relationships with married men for material gain are not just morally bankrupt but are actively contributing to the destruction of families.

"You're wicked if you intentionally date a married man for benefits," he wrote, making it clear that he believes such behaviour deserves to be called out and condemned.

The media personality's comments have sparked a heated debate, with some agreeing that women who date married men should be held accountable for their actions, while others have argued that the blame should fall primarily on the married man.

Regha maintained that both parties are culpable, but that women who intentionally pursue married men for financial gain are particularly problematic because they are knowingly participating in the breakdown of a family unit.

He urged women to have more respect for themselves and for other women, rather than contributing to the pain and heartbreak of a fellow woman.

Regha also noted that the culture of dating married men for benefits has become increasingly normalized in Nigerian society, particularly on social media, where some women openly brag about their relationships with wealthy married men.

He argued that this normalization is dangerous and sends the wrong message to young girls who look up to these women as role models.

His comments have resonated with many who believe that the glorification of such relationships is a symptom of a deeper moral crisis in society.

The debate has also touched on the economic factors that drive some women into such relationships, with some arguing that poverty and desperation often leave women with few options.

Regha acknowledged these challenges but insisted that poverty should not be an excuse for immoral behaviour. He urged society to address the underlying economic issues that make women vulnerable to exploitation, while also holding individuals accountable for their choices.

As the conversation continues, Regha's message serves as a reminder that the choices individuals make have consequences not just for themselves but for the people around them.

His willingness to speak out on such a sensitive topic has sparked an important conversation about morality, accountability, and the role of women in the breakdown of families.
